Architecture
The Bengtskär Lighthouse is a sturdy tower with a distinctive gray color. It stands at a height of 52 meters (171 feet) above sea level, with its focal point located 51 meters (167 feet) above the waterline.
The lighthouse features a characteristic cylindrical shape and a lantern room at its top.

Current Status
The Bengtskär Lighthouse remains an active aid to navigation, although it has been automated in recent years.
While it is still used by mariners, it is no longer manned by a keeper.
Location and Accessibility
The Bengtskär Lighthouse is located on the island of Bengtskär, off the coast of Kimitoön, Finland.
The lighthouse can be accessed via a small boat or ferry from the nearby town of Kimitoön.
Visitors can explore the lighthouse's grounds and admire its striking architecture.
Heritage Status
The Bengtskär Lighthouse is listed as a protected landmark in Finland, recognizing its importance to the country's maritime heritage.
